Citizens Advice Staffordshire North and Stoke-on-Trent provides free, confidential, and impartial advice to help people resolve their problems and improve their lives. Each year, we support over 20,000 local people with around 55,000 new issues, offering guidance on a wide range of topics.

Our specialist areas include:

  • Social security benefits
  • Personal debt
  • Housing issues and homelessness
  • Employment disputes
  • Immigration and asylum support
  • Support for victims of crime

Our holistic approach means we look at your whole situation, providing tailored advice and, where needed, referrals to specialist services or external agencies. We are registered with the Immigration Advice Authority (IAA).

Accessibility: All our premises are designed to be accessible for people with physical disabilities, mobility, or sensory impairments. We strive to make our services welcoming and inclusive for all communities in the local area.
